Summary:This document contains information on the vocational/career education programs which have been funded by the 1968 Vocational Amendments and Wisconsin's 17 vocational technical and adult education districts to provide services to special needs students. It is designed to assist teachers and administrators in the Vocational, Technical and Adult Education (VTAE) system in identifying and sharing common areas of interest as they provide services to students. Both sections, Section I, Disadvantaged and Handicapped Occupational Programs, and Section II, Consumer and Homemaking Education Programs for Disadvantaged and Handicapped, list project/program entries by district and categorize each according to pre-vocational, supportive service, or curriculum areas. Each entry includes a descriptive title, location (address and telephone number), information and administrative contact, type of handicapped student served, and a brief program description. The index provides a quick reference for the identification of programs by area. (HD)
